Techical spesification

Max suction capacity, cfm: 162
Max pressure, inch H2O: 192.9
Max vacuum, inch H2O: -164.8
Number of stages: 2
Rated power, HP: 6.25
Electric supply, Phase: 3
Sound pressure level, dB(A): 74
Dimentions LxWxH, Inch: 19.6x14.6x14.6
Connections, Inch: G2
Weight, lbs: 97

Description

The VL 162.193 is a high-performance regenerative blower designed for use in a variety of industrial applications. This blower is capable of generating a maximum suction capacity of 162 cfm, a maximum pressure of 192.9 inch H2O, and a maximum vacuum of -164.8 inch H2O, making it ideal for applications that require high levels of airflow and pressure.

The VL 162.193 features a two-stage design, which provides increased pressure and vacuum capabilities compared to single-stage blowers. It has a rated power of 6.25 HP, which makes it suitable for use in demanding applications that require high levels of performance. The blower operates on a three-phase electric supply, providing consistent and reliable power to the unit.

With a sound pressure level of 74 dB(A), the VL 162.193 is relatively noisy compared to other blowers, making it more suitable for use in industrial environments rather than noise-sensitive applications.

The VL 162.193 has a large footprint, with dimensions of 19.6x14.6x14.6 inches, and a weight of 97 lbs. It is equipped with G2 connections, which allow for easy integration into existing systems.

Overall, the VL 162.193 is a powerful and efficient regenerative blower that is designed for industrial applications that require high levels of airflow and pressure. Its two-stage design and high rated power make it suitable for use in demanding applications, while its large size and weight make it more suitable for use in stationary applications.
